Six-year-old Nancy loves being fancy, from her advanced vocabulary to elaborate outfits. She navigates life's adventures using ingenuity and imagination, learning to celebrate what makes eve... Those who give this show a bad rating obviously didn't stick around for the whole episode. Nancy ALWAYS learns her lesson, whether she was mean to Jojo or didn't include someone or realizes her dog is perfect even if he's not as fancy as Miss Divine's dog. There's such a thing called a SET UP in a story so that there's a PAY OFF at the end. GOOD shows use this so they don't end up like Mickey Mouse Clubhouse where characters can't even make a mistake for fear of it being seen by people as a "bad example to our children." News flash - kids won't ever be perfect, so let's give them a RELATABLE main character instead of a flat, lifeless one.
Anywho - Nancy is one of those rare shows that to me hearkens back to the day when a moral wasnt needed in a story to make it accessible to children (i.e. Ducktails, Talespin, gummi bears, etc...) Its simple, sweet, well-written, witty, and true to the storybooks while charting its own path. It's a show I never hesitate to let my girls watch whenever they want. The music too is quality for a 2018 disney channel show. It's a breath of fresh air and a show I enjoy watching along with my kids.

One reviewer said Nancy was not a good role model. I disagree. When Nancy gets upset because things don't turn out the way she expects or wants, a parent, grandparent, neighbor, or friend is quick to point out her "bad" behavior. Nancy becomes remorseful and apologizes for her actions, most importantly, she learns from her mistakes. That is what my three year old granddaughter gets from the show. We all make mistakes, the important thing is to learn and grow from them. This show is the only current cartoon I personally can stomach to watch. I think Disney is making a colossal (that's fancy for really big) mistake by canceling Fancy Nancy.
